Answer: 2x^2 + 6x - 4</h3>
=================================
Work Shown:
f(x) - g(x) = [ f(x) ] - [ g(x) ]
f(x) - g(x) = ( 3x^2+x-3) - ( x^2-5x+1 )
f(x) - g(x) = 3x^2+x-3 - x^2+5x-1
f(x) - g(x) = (3x^2-x^2) + (x+5x) + (-3-1)
f(x) - g(x) = 2x^2 + 6x - 4

The imaginary number <em>i</em> signifies the imaginary part of a complex number. The imaginary part of the number is the coefficient of <em>i</em>. The real part is everything else.
__
In (a +bi), (a) is the real part, and (b) is the imaginary part.
In (-9 +8i), (-9) is the real part and (8) is the imaginary part.
